Inside, the cabin received a full color refresh and presents very
well. The interior was reworked from the original Medium Metallic
Blue to a new scheme that looks fresh and cohesive. Seats, door
panels, and trim show careful attention and fit the car's overall
appearance. A period radio and owner documentation including a
service manual are shown in the photos.
Under the hood is a Summit Racing 350 small block reported to have
fewer than 1,000 miles since its build and fitted with an Edelbrock
intake for improved breathing. A two-speed Powerglide automatic was
refreshed in December 2024, reportedly serviced for smooth
operation. The car rides on stock A-arm front and trailing arm rear
suspension with coil springs and added air shocks. Braking is
original style with drum brakes front and rear and a 10-bolt rear
axle.
